Hey everybody!

Ever since I built my first computer a month ago, I've been lurking around finding ways to improve my experience using said computer. That's when I landed on a thread explaining mechanical keyboards. After reading that thread, the rest was history. I ended up getting a Filco Ninja TKL with Cherry Blacks, since I really liked the semi-look blank, but I'm still not a touch-typist yet.

Now the funny part of this is ever since I got the board a few days ago, I've been doing a lot of research about keycaps. One thing that seemed to come up really often is the ABS keycaps on the Filco starts getting its shine a lot sooner than a lot of the other ones out there. So now, I'm on the hunt to find a keycap to preserve my awesome Ninja keys, defeating the entire purpose of me getting this board. :(

Well I join this site after finding it pop up in a lot of the search results I was seeing. Hopefully I'll able to make a little more of an informed decision since there seems to be a lot of great information here! LOL

"Because keyboards are accessories to PC makers, they focus on minimizing the manufacturing costs. But that’s incorrect. It’s in HHKB’s slogan, but when America’s cowboys were in the middle of a trip and their horse died, they would leave the horse there. But even if they were in the middle of a desert, they would take their saddle with them. The horse was a consumable good, but the saddle was an interface that their bodies had gotten used to. In the same vein, PCs are consumable goods, while keyboards are important interfaces." - Eiiti Wada

Take the Toxic set, for example: http://geekhack.org/index.php?topic=38241.0

Currently there are 207 people who have ordered, so the price for a set is $57.15.  If we can get another 43 people to order, the price will drop to $56.12.  Not a huge drop, I admit, but if only 25 people had ordered then a set would have cost $93.19.
